50 * Defines a RECURRENCE-ID iCalendar component property. |
|
51 * |
|
52 * <pre> |
|
53 * 4.8.4.4 Recurrence ID |
|
54 * |
|
55 * Property Name: RECURRENCE-ID |
|
56 * |
|
57 * Purpose: This property is used in conjunction with the "UID" and |
|
58 * "SEQUENCE" property to identify a specific instance of a recurring |
|
59 * "VEVENT", "VTODO" or "VJOURNAL" calendar component. The property |
|
60 * value is the effective value of the "DTSTART" property of the |
|
61 * recurrence instance. |
|
62 * |
|
63 * Value Type: The default value type for this property is DATE-TIME. |
|
64 * The time format can be any of the valid forms defined for a DATE-TIME |
|
65 * value type. See DATE-TIME value type definition for specific |
|
66 * interpretations of the various forms. The value type can be set to |
|
67 * DATE. |
|
68 * |
|
69 * Property Parameters: Non-standard property, value data type, time |
|
70 * zone identifier and recurrence identifier range parameters can be |
|
71 * specified on this property. |
|
72 * |
|
73 * Conformance: This property can be specified in an iCalendar object |
|
74 * containing a recurring calendar component. |
|
75 * |
|
76 * Description: The full range of calendar components specified by a |
|
77 * recurrence set is referenced by referring to just the "UID" property |
|
78 * value corresponding to the calendar component. The "RECURRENCE-ID" |
|
79 * property allows the reference to an individual instance within the |
|
80 * recurrence set. |
|
81 * |
|
82 * If the value of the "DTSTART" property is a DATE type value, then the |
|
83 * value MUST be the calendar date for the recurrence instance. |
|
84 * |
|
85 * The date/time value is set to the time when the original recurrence |
|
86 * instance would occur; meaning that if the intent is to change a |
|
87 * Friday meeting to Thursday, the date/time is still set to the |
|
88 * original Friday meeting. |
|
89 * |
|
90 * The "RECURRENCE-ID" property is used in conjunction with the "UID" |
|
91 * and "SEQUENCE" property to identify a particular instance of a |
|
92 * recurring event, to-do or journal. For a given pair of "UID" and |
|
93 * "SEQUENCE" property values, the "RECURRENCE-ID" value for a |
|
94 * recurrence instance is fixed. When the definition of the recurrence |
|
95 * set for a calendar component changes, and hence the "SEQUENCE" |
|
96 * property value changes, the "RECURRENCE-ID" for a given recurrence |
|
97 * instance might also change.The "RANGE" parameter is used to specify |
|
98 * the effective range of recurrence instances from the instance |
|
99 * specified by the "RECURRENCE-ID" property value. The default value |
|
100 * for the range parameter is the single recurrence instance only. The |
|
101 * value can also be "THISANDPRIOR" to indicate a range defined by the |
|
102 * given recurrence instance and all prior instances or the value can be |
|
103 * "THISANDFUTURE" to indicate a range defined by the given recurrence |
|
104 * instance and all subsequent instances. |
